Citigroup Inc., formed in 1998 through the landmark merger of Citicorp and Travelers Group, with roots tracing back to the 1812 founding of City Bank of New York, is a global financial powerhouse headquartered in New York City, managing trillions in assets. Operating in over 160 countries, Citigroup offers a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king (via Citibank), investment banking, wealth management, and trading, serving millions of retail customers and major corporations, governments, and institutions worldwide. Under CEO Jane Fraser since 2021—the first woman to lead a major U.S. bank—Citigroup has focused on streamlining operations, exiting consumer banking in 13 markets to bolster its institutional and wealth management focus, while navigating post-2008 regulatory scrutiny and fines. Known for its vast global footprint and resilience through crises, Citigroup remains a key player in international finance, blending retail accessibility with high-stakes capital markets expertise.

Citigroup's Q4 2023 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2023, Citigroup held 5,981 positions worth $142B, up 6.1% from $134B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

Citigroup withdrew a net $7.69B in Q4 2023, closing 303 positions and reducing 1,438 holdings. Its most notable exit was Activision Blizzard, an estimated $83.6M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 13% of assets, up from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Citigroup opened a new position in State Street SPDR S&P 600 Small Cap Growth ETF worth $132M.

  • Citigroup's largest Q4 2023 buy was State Street SPDR S&P 600 Small Cap Growth ETF: 1,575,614 shares worth $132M.
  • Citigroup added most to Alphabet (Google) Class A in Q4 2023, an estimated $248M increase.
  • Citigroup's biggest Q4 2023 reduction was Invesco QQQ Trust, cutting an estimated $588M.
  • Citigroup fully exited Activision Blizzard in Q4 2023, selling an estimated $83.6M.
  • Citigroup's ten largest holdings make up 26% of its $142B portfolio in Q4 2023.
  • Citigroup opened 344 new positions and closed 303 in Q4 2023.
  • Citigroup's portfolio value rose 6.1% quarter-over-quarter to $142B.

Based on Citigroup's 13F filing for Q4 2023, filed 9 Feb 2024.
